8 Best WordPress Plugins for Nonprofits, Charities, and NGOs

When it comes to the world of nonprofits, charities, and NGOs, the organizations are built on the collective efforts of passionate individuals, striving to make the world a better place. However, passion alone isn’t if you want a better online presence.

Whether you want to build a site, want donations, or make people sign up for some excellent charity work, you will need tools. As you’re a nonprofit/charity, it’s expected that you won’t have the budget and technical expertise on sites. But fear not, as we’ve brought you the 8 Best WordPress Plugins for Nonprofits, Charities, and NGOs. 

From building a site from scratch & ranking it to donation management & gathering email lists- everything is made easy with these plugins. These plugins are reliable, and you won’t have to test out several ones to find the best for you, as experts have done the testing part. 

Let’s start, shall we?









Thrive Leads

Lead Generation

Ultimate Blocks


Fluent Forms


Rank Math


Event Tickets


Social Snap


Powered By WP Table Builder

1. GiveWP

Donation is the main source of money for charities and many nonprofit organizations. Though online fundraising has risen rapidly in recent years, it’s hard to choose the right tool for the job, with so many options available. That’s where GiveWP shines, with its easy-to-use donation forms, donor management features, seamless payment gateway integration, and customizable add-ons, making it one of the best donation plugins for your site.    

One of the core features of GiveWP is its ability to create highly customizable donation forms that can be easily embedded on your WordPress site. Along with efficiently designing forms, you can choose from various field types, such as single or multi-level donations, recurring donations, and even custom fields to gather donor information or special requests.

Consistent, recurring donations are crucial for any nonprofit or charity’s growth and long-term success. GiveWP makes it simple for your donors to give recurring donations, by enabling them to choose their preferred frequency (e.g., monthly, quarterly, or annually). This feature will build long-term relationships with your organization’s patrons and supporters, as well as help you develop a sustainable funding source. 

With GiveWP, you can choose from various payment gateway options to provide your donors with a secure and convenient payment method that aligns with their preferences. In addition to popular choices like Stripe and PayPal, the platform supports other gateways such as Square, Authorize.Net, Bitpay, etc. Additionally, GiveWP’s fee recovery tool lets donors pay the transaction cost, adding to your cause and enhancing its impact.

Key Features

  • Features highly customizable donation forms.
  • Offers customized recurring donation option. 
  • Provides insightful reports on donations.
  • Fantastic donor management.
  • Multiple payment gateways option.
  • Features simple peer-to-peer fundraising. 
  • Seamless integration with popular page builders.
  • Supports multiple currencies.


Free | Basic plan for GiveWP starts at an annual fee of $149. 

2. Paymattic

Looking for a more affordable plugin that will be on par with similar powerful plugins, in terms of donation? If you are, then Paymattic is the choice for you. It’s not limited to donations; it offers customized and even subscription payments, making it an allrounder. With its seamless integration, multiple payment gateways, easy management, and customization options, Paymattic is the perfect budget-friendly solution. 

The plugin’s intuitive drag-and-drop form builder allows you to create beautiful, customized payment forms that suit your website’s design and style. You can add various fields to your forms, such as text inputs, dropdown menus, checkboxes, and radio buttons. This feature simplifies collecting the necessary information from your users, ensuring smooth transactions and a better overall user experience.

The fundraising tools offered by these plugins are spectacular. You can use features like crowdfunding and peer-to-peer funding to raise a hefty amount. And not only that, Paymattic allows you to collect funding in 135+ currencies, making donation efforts global and more effective. The built-in donation feature also allows your donors to make recurring donations.

Detailed statistics and reports are at your fingertips with Paymattic. From a single page, you can easily track the performance of your payment forms, monitor the donations, and view detailed transaction records. You will be given complex graphs and charts for a better performance understanding.  This will help you make informed decisions and optimize your organization’s strategy.

Key Features

  • Offers unlimited payment forms.
  • Features 9 different payment gateways.
  • Has email and sms notification systems.
  • PCI DSS & SCA support for improved security. 
  • Offers email automation via FluentCRM.
  • Offers 135+ currency support.
  • Advanced reporting and analytics.
  • Features both one-time and recurring donations, with donation goals. 


Free | Paymattic is set at $4.99/month, billed annually.

3. Thrive Leads

Getting donations is tough, but what if you find a source of procuring new donors/volunteers constantly? A fantastic way of doing so is by generating leads and converting them into supporters or donors. Thrive Leads excels at this, by creating eye-catching, high-converting opt-in forms for your website, enabling you to grow your email list, thus creating a potential line of future supporters for your organization.

One of the most compelling features of Thrive Leads is its advanced targeting capabilities. The plugin allows you to tailor your opt-in forms based on different visitor types, making it easier to customize messages for different audiences. For example, you could create specific notes for first-time visitors, repeat donors, or long-term volunteers. 

Thrive Leads provides an advanced built-in A/B testing engine, allowing you to test different form designs, content, and triggers to determine what works best for your audience. This feature is especially beneficial for charities and NGOs that often operate on tight budgets, and must ensure their online strategies are as effective as possible.

Thrive Leads comes with an advanced analytics suite, that provides valuable insights into how your opt-in forms perform. You can see exactly where your leads are coming from, which forms are the most effective, and how your A/B tests perform. For nonprofits and charities, this data is invaluable for strategizing and optimizing your online engagement efforts. 

Key Features

  • Intuitive drag-and-drop editor for simplified form building.
  • Powerful A/B testing engine for strategic decision-making.
  • Advanced targeting and personalization. 
  • Offers detailed reporting and insights. 
  • Features SmartLinks and SmartExit+ for conversion boosting. 
  • Offers a diverse range of form templates/
  • Has a content-locking option.
  • Seamless API integrations with the most popular email services.


Unfortunately, there is no free version of Thrive Leads. However, the premium version is affordable at $99/year. 

4. Ultimate Blocks

Okay, we’ve talked about donating and email listing tools. But what if you need to build a site from the start? Fear not, because Ultimate Blocks is here to the rescue. It is a WordPress plugin specifically designed for the Gutenberg block editor, allowing you to build a functional and stunning-looking site by just dragging & dropping blocks, without even writing any codes. 

The blocks provided by Ultimate Blocks are the best thing about this plugin. There are 48 different types of blocks for various purposes. So, it’s guaranteed that, you won’t have to face any lack of tools while setting up your WordPress site. Additionally, you can switch off or disable any block anytime you want, without affecting your site. 

While Ultimate Blocks is packed with features, it doesn’t compromise performance. On top of the block disabling/enabling option, the plugin is built to be lightweight and efficient, ensuring it doesn’t slow down your website. Plus, it’s incredibly user-friendly. Even if you’re new to WordPress, you can easily navigate the plugin and fully utilize its features.

SEO is vital for any site, especially for non-profits and charities, as ranking higher in searches means getting more reach and traffic. Devs of Ultimate Blocks know this and built this plugin with the best SEO practice. With two different schema types available in the plugin, this plugin is highly optimized for search engines. 

Key Features

  • Offers an intuitive and user-friendly interface. 
  • Has an extensive range of blocks.
  • Completely free of any charge.
  • Allows heavy customization.
  • Lightweight, speed optimized, and mobile responsive.
  • Offers a well-crafted CTA block to increase engagement and conversions significantly.
  • SEO optimization, with two different schemas. 
  • Features block disable/enable option.



5. Fluent Forms

Suppose, you need a team of volunteers for your organization. But how do you make people sign up for that? You need an eye-catching form, that attracts visitors and makes them enlist for your cause. And to do so, Fluent Forms can be your best choice. With a simple interface, easy setup, and many features, this plugin is great for nonprofits of all sizes.

Fluent Forms offers a simple drag-and-drop interface that makes creating contact forms a breeze. With more than 70 pre-built form templates, you can quickly set up registration forms, donation forms, volunteer applications, and more for your charity or nonprofit. The intuitive builder allows you to create forms with multiple columns, add various input fields, and customize the design to match your organization’s branding.

Fluent Forms’ one of the best features is the advanced conditional logic. It will allow you to create more dynamic and personalized forms. This feature enables you to show or hide fields based on user input, ensuring your supporters only see relevant questions. For instance, you can set up a form that only displays volunteer opportunities when visitors indicate they’re interested in volunteering. 

Fluent Forms makes the donation process seamless. It integrates with popular payment gateways like PayPal and Stripe, allowing you to receive donations securely and directly through your forms. The plugin also offers dynamic calculation, automatically calculating the money you’ll receive. For example, if a donor wants to contribute a certain amount monthly, the form can calculate and display the total annual contribution.

Key Features

  • Has 70+ pre-built form templates.
  • Features conditional logic for more intelligent forms.
  • Spam protection with Akismet, reCAPTCHA, Honeypot, etc.
  • Dynamic calculation feature.
  • Popular payment gateway integration. 
  • Supports multi-step form creation.
  • Offers advanced email notification features. 
  • Offers flexible customization options. 


Free | Single site license for Fluent Forms starts at $41/year. 

6. Rank Math

As a vital component of every organization’s online strategy, SEO has become a critical tool for charities, nonprofits, and NGOs striving to boost online visibility, reach more people, and ultimately make a more significant impact. And Rank Math SEO can be just the perfect plugin for the job, with its intelligent features, smart automation, and powerful analytics.

One of the most impressive features of this plugin is the advanced schema generator. There are 16+ different types of schema markups available in Rank Math SEO. By directly providing rich snippets like images, star ratings, or event details in the search results, Rank Math SEO can make your content more fascinating to potential supporters and donors.

One of the standout features of Rank Math SEO is its ability to conduct a comprehensive SEO analysis. This tool offers 30 in-depth SEO tests, all of which can assist you in efficiently optimizing your website. It detects areas of weakness, makes suggestions for changes, and even provides insights that can be put into action to improve your SEO approach. 

Rank Math also features XML sitemap generation, 404 trackings, and redirection management. The XML sitemap generator generates a sitemap of your website’s pages for search engines to index better. The 404 monitoring function warns users when visitors encounter broken links on their website, and the redirection manager helps users redirect broken links to active pages to avoid issues.

Key Features

  • Offers AI content writing.
  • Features a built-in analytics module.
  • Offers .htaccess editor, XMP sitemap, and 404 monitors. 
  • Integrates with Google Analytics 4.
  • Offers rank tracker for tracking your keywords and search engine rankings. 
  • 16+ schema markup generator.
  • Offers automated advanced image SEO.
  • Supports schema markup importing.


Free | Premium plan of Rank Math SEO starts at $59/year. 

7. Event Tickets

In the world of charities, nonprofits, and NGOs, events are more than just gatherings – they’re opportunities to engage with patrons and potential backers, raise funds, and further your efforts. That’s where Event Tickets shines. With flexible ticketing options, robust attendee management, customizable registration forms, and secure payment processing, this WordPress plugin is an invaluable resource for organizations, to manage event attendees and tickets without hassle. 

Event Tickets is designed to be user-friendly, making it easy for even novice WordPress users to set up and manage their events. With a few simple clicks, you can create tickets, set prices, and handle registration forms, allowing you to focus on what matters most – your event at hand and the attendees who will participate.

When managing an event, keeping track of attendees and their information is crucial. Event Tickets offers powerful attendee management features that enable you to view and manage attendee lists, check in attendees, and communicate with them via email. Additionally, this tool is compatible with multiple payment gateways, ensuring a smooth transaction experience for donors. 

In today’s data-driven world, understanding your audience is critical to making a more significant impact. Event Tickets offers powerful reporting features, providing valuable insights into sales and attendee data. With these reports, you can effectively tweak and build your future events, ensuring they perform better with your audience. This helps improve attendance rates and drives more donations for your cause.

Key Features

  • Offers customizable ticket templates.
  • Seamless integration with PayPal and Stripe.
  • Offers shortcode support. 
  • Features customizable registration fields.
  • Provides exportable attendee reports. 
  • Has ticket stock countdown to create urgency.
  • Provides digital wallets. 
  • Has premium support access.


Free | Event Ticket Plus is $99/year, for a single site license. 

8. Social Snap

Social media has become an indispensable tool for charities, nonprofits, and NGOs, to raise awareness, engage with supporters, and drive fundraising efforts. So, a powerful social media plugin is essential for maximizing your organization’s online impact. By offering eye-catching social share buttons, Click to Tweet functionality, and customizable designs, Social Snap is just the plugin for the job. 

One of Social Snap’s standout features is its attractive and customizable social share buttons. These buttons enable visitors to share your content directly from the website, across multiple platforms, including Facebook, Twitter, LinkedIn, Pinterest, and many more. It’s an efficient way to amplify the reach of your content, spreading your cause to potential supporters, volunteers, or donors.

The Click to Tweet feature is another powerful tool Social Snap provides, allowing you to create tweetable quotes or snippets directly within your content. When visitors click on these quotes, they will be shared on Twitter with a link to your website. This function helps charities and NGOs generate viral moments or highlight vital information, data, and statements.

Another helpful feature of Social Snap is the share counter, which showcases your social media presence by displaying the number of shares (both individual and total) your content have across various platforms. By highlighting those numbers, you can demonstrate credibility and trustworthiness to potential supporters and donors. These counters can be customized to match your website’s design and placed anywhere on your site. 

Key Features

  • Customizable social share button, with over 30 popular social media platform integration.
  • Fantastic share counter with individual and total share counts.
  • Effective Click to Tweet buttons.
  • Shortcodes, widgets, and Gutenberg support.
  • Social auto poster for automated content publishing.
  • Features old post boosting.
  • Share count recovery.
  • Advanced statistics with track engagement. 


Free | Social Snap Pro is set at $99 per year.


In this digital era, your website is your first impression, and it’s your opportunity to tell your story, gather support, and inspire change. And the right plugins can be the key to easing off the workload. 

And we hope the ‘8 Best WordPress Plugins for Nonprofits, Charities, and NGOs’ will help you find the right one. Remember, each plugin serves a unique purpose, so understanding your organization’s needs is critical to choosing the right ones. But never be afraid of mixing and matching up plugins; find the best ones by experimenting. As almost all the plugins on this list have free versions, try those out first, and buy premium ones afterward.

And if you’ve liked this write-up, please share it with other like-minded acquaintances. And ask anything regarded this article in the comment section; we’ll be happy to answer and solve your issue. 

Good Luck! 

Affiliate Disclosure: This post contains affiliate links. That means if you make a purchase using any of these links, we will get a small commission without any extra cost to you. Thank you for your support.

Leave a Comment

Scroll to Top